White House Adviser Accuses James Rosen of ‘Attacking My Character’

By Mark Joyella 

Hours after a State Department spokesman publicly thanked Fox News Channel correspondent James Rosen for his role in uncovering that video of a State Department media briefing had been edited to remove questions Rosen had asked about Iran, a former State Department spokesperson–and current adviser to President Obama–has accused Rosen of “attacking my character.”

In a letter to Rosen, Jen Psaki said “you have spent the last three weeks vilifying me on television without any evidence of my knowledge or involvement and without once reaching out and asking me,” about the briefing video.

While some have hinted that Psaki may have knowledge of how the video came to be edited, Rosen said Thursday he has never questioned Psaki’s character, nor suggested or implied she was responsible for editing the footage.

It was in response to a question from Rosen that Psaki wrote her email, stressing she had no role in the edited video, and accusing Rosen of targeting her. “Hopefully you will find the time to spend on the range of global events happening in the world in between attacking my character.”

The full email exchange is as follows:

ROSEN EMAIL

Jen,

Some have pointed to a certain aspect of your statement, highlighted below, as not removing yourself from consideration for having issued the order to edit the briefing video:

I had no knowledge of nor would I have approved of any form of editing or cutting my briefing transcript on any subject while at the State Department. I believe deeply in providing the press as much information on important issues as possible.

Of course, as Liz Trudeau and others have stressed, the briefing transcript remained unaltered the entire time. Do you want to issue a revised statement, asserting the same for the video, which was altered?

Forgive me if you have already put out something along these lines and I missed it.

Yours cordially,

James

PSAKI RESPONSE

James,

My statement applies to the video which is considered a form of the transcript and every aspect of this.

I understand it is inconvenient for you that I have nothing to do with this given you have spent the last three weeks vilifying me on television without any evidence of my knowledge or involvement and without once reaching out and asking me, but I would encourage you to also ask the State Department if there is any evidence. A shred or any information at all that suggests I had any knowledge of this or any connection to this on any level. Hopefully you will find the time to spend on the range of global events happening in the world in between attacking my character.

Consider that on the record from me as well

Thanks
